Output e50f436c9626a539f1c86d08099e260a2c86f9b2c4fd2822bc8c90b0e6e8ba6e:0

value
500664227
script pubkey
OP_0 OP_PUSHBYTES_20 2677ea020a5e9adba2092a430bce96fc8d25bd32
address
ltc1qyem75qs2t6ddhgsf9fpshn5kljxjt0fj8s77qk
transaction
e50f436c9626a539f1c86d08099e260a2c86f9b2c4fd2822bc8c90b0e6e8ba6e
spent
true